Scope and Mechanistic Analysis of the Enantioselective Synthesis of Allenes by Rhodium-Catalyzed Tandem Ylide Formation/[2,3]-Sigmatropic Rearrangement between Donor/Acceptor Carbenoids and Propargylic Alcohols
作者:Zhanjie Li、Vyacheslav Boyarskikh、Jørn H. Hansen、Jochen Autschbach、Djamaladdin G. Musaev、Huw M. L. Davies
DOI:10.1021/ja3061529
日期:2012.9.19
Rhodium-catalyzed reactions of tertiary propargylic alcohols with methyl aryl- and styryldiazoacetates result in tandem reactions, consisting of oxonium ylide formation followed by [2,3]-sigmatropic rearrangement. This process competes favorably with the standard O-H insertion reaction of carbenoids.
